USCIS administers the Immigrant Investor Program, also known as “EB-5,” created by Congress in 1990 to stimulate the U.S. economy through job creation and capital investment by foreign investors.
Under a pilot immigration program first enacted in 1992 and regularly reauthorized since, certain EB5 visas also are set aside for investors in Regional Centers designated by USCIS based on proposals for promoting economic growth.
Under this program, investors (and their spouses and unmarried children under 21) are eligible to apply for a Green Card (permanent residence). They are allowed to live and work anywhere in the US, irrespective of where the Regional Centre is located.
